Output 84f967bb7253d780087869c6578bab0894c3b11f29d6210fefac82e39c3fbd14:7

value
23700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 579a75f4e4b80a49db0ba895b68070f2a49e3a97 OP_EQUALVERIFY OP_CHECKSIG
address
18zCpp55GnB2r55647kC6QgbUKhz881v8y
transaction
84f967bb7253d780087869c6578bab0894c3b11f29d6210fefac82e39c3fbd14